Role Overview
This is a pivotal leadership role responsible for driving knowledge management strategy and operations across Gilbert + Tobin and with clients. Reporting to Caryn Sandler, Partner + Chief Knowledge and Innovation Officer, and managing a team of Knowledge Lawyers, you will be responsible for:
- Driving the transformation of the firm’s knowledge assets into strategic, AI-enabled capabilities, in close consultation with the Partner + Chief Knowledge and Innovation Officer and Practice Group Knowledge Partners.
- Developing and executing the firm’s enterprise knowledge strategy in alignment with AI, client value and productivity objectives.
- Leading the structuring, classification and governance of legal knowledge to optimise AI retrieval, accuracy and reuse. Developing policies for AI-enabled knowledge creation, maintenance and quality assurance.
- Managing specific knowledge, innovation and quality projects requiring close liaison and project co-management with G+T lawyers and practice groups, IT, Risk, Marketing/BD, HR and Library.
- Communicating knowledge and innovation initiatives to practice groups, partners and the firm.
- Identifying opportunities to productise legal knowledge and improve client delivery.
- Supporting the development of client-facing knowledge solutions.
- Continuing to lead and develop a high-performing knowledge function.
- Convening and chairing meetings of the Knowledge Partner group.
- Facilitating regular Knowledge meetings to ensure consistency of policy and content development across the firm.
